Coax Cable : Buried ? On-the-Ground ? In-the-Air ?
- - - For Safety and Durability
http://groups.yahoo.com/group/Shortw...a/message/9091

The main reason for Burying the Coax Cable is that it will
Last Longer in-the-ground 3-10 Years vice having people
step directly on it or things rolling over it for the same
number of years. The simple fact is that Coax Cable "ON"
the Surface of the Ground is subject to more wear-and-tear
then Coax Cable "Buried" Under-the-Ground.

Use a Mattock or Pick with a 3" Trench / Drain Shovel
http://www.lowes.com/lowes/lkn?actio...denToolBG.html
http://www.lowes.com/lowes/lkn?actio...nToolBG.html#7


A shallow Trench that is about 3"-4" Wide and about 4"-6" Deep
will do 10'-20' a Day for a Week will get any job done in time.

If the Coax Cable can not be Buried then consider buying
a cheap Garden Hose and placing the Coax Cable inside
the Hose to protect the Coax Cable from Wear-and-Tear.
If necessary in High Traffic Areas build or buy a few
"Step-Overs" (Roll-Overs) to cover the Coax Cable from
Foot and Ground. You can use Electrical Cord Runners
as Step-Overs for Coax Cable in Out-Door locations.

ALTERNATIVES :
* Run-Route the Coax Cable 'out-of-the-way' along a Fence
or Wall about one foot off the ground.
* Up in the Air at least Ten Feet (10') above the ground.
